At fourteen, Jesse Livermore talked his way into a Boston brokerage for six dollars a week β and secretly started beating the house. By sixteen, he had made his first thousand dollars trading in illegal off-exchange gambling dens called bucket shops, using only pattern analysis he had developed in two handwritten notebooks. His first recorded profit was $3.12 on a Burlington stock trade in 1892.
